You can find almost anything in here, especially dried fruits and nuts etc... You should always expect to do some bargaining especially if you aren’t local. Also, you shouldn’t directly buy what you’ve gone shopping for from the first seller. It’s always better to keep looking then compare prices, quality etc and then make your decision.
